C#

En iyi Programlama Dili Hangisidir

Merhaba arkada┼člar ,
Bug├╝n sizlere en iyi programlama dili hangisidir bundan bahsedece─čim. Yani ├Âyle bir dil olmad─▒─č─▒ndan bahsedece─čim :). Programlamaya ba┼člayan herkes ilk ba┼člad─▒klar─▒nda en iyi programlama dili hangisidir deyip o dili ├Â─črenmeye ├žal─▒┼č─▒yor . Fakat bu yanl─▒┼č bir d├╝┼č├╝nce ve davran─▒┼čt─▒r.

├ľncelikle ┼čunu s├Âyleyeyim En iyi programlama dili denen bir┼čey yoktur. Yani programlama dillerinin en iyisi bu diyebilece─čimiz bir dil yoktur. Sana g├Âre delphi ├žok iyidir kalitelidir bana g├Âre ise C# ├žok iyi bir dildir. Ama ger├žek olan bir┼čey var hangi i┼či yapacaksak ne tarzda programlar yazacaksak yazaca─č─▒m─▒z programlara uygun dili bulabiliriz. ┼×imdi ben ├žok kaliteli grafiklere sahip bir oyun yazmak istiyorum. Gider C# ile delphi ile yazmaya kalkarsam bu ├žok b├╝y├╝k bir yanl─▒┼č olur ve kesinlikle de yaz─▒lamaz. ├çok iyi bir oyun i├žin c, open gl studio .. Gibi programlar kullan─▒lmak zorundad─▒r. Peki C# ile delphi ile oyun yazamaz m─▒y─▒z?. Tabiki yazabiliriz fakat k├╝├ž├╝k ├žapta grafik istemeyen oyunlar yazabiliriz. Mesela adam asmaca , passaparola , say─▒ bulmaca , resim e┼čle┼čeni bulma vb. Gibi k├╝├ž├╝k ├žapta oyunlar─▒ yazabiliriz.

programlama-dilleri

Programlaman─▒n en temeli 1 ve 0 lara dayan─▒r. Bir ├╝st k─▒sm─▒ c programlama dilidir. Programlama dillerinin babas─▒ olarak g├Âsterebiliriz C dilini :). ┼×imdi C# ile delphi ile vb.net ile neler yap─▒labilir yani en uygun hangi tarz programlar yaz─▒labilir bundan bahsedelim birazda. Bu programlama dilleri ile piyasada ├žo─čunlukla stok takip tarz─▒ programlar yaz─▒lmaktad─▒r. Market takip , depo takip , nalbur takip gibi. Tabi farkl─▒ olarak her t├╝rl├╝ akla gelebilecek programda yaz─▒labilir. Mesela benim ge├ženlerde , elimde 5000 adet resim vard─▒ bu resimlerin isimleri d├╝zenlenecekti. Tek tek elimle d├╝zenlemeye kalksam en az 3 4 saatimi al─▒rd─▒ ve ├žok yorulurdum fakat hemen C# ─▒ a├žarak birka├ž sat─▒r kod ile b├╝t├╝n resimlerin ayn─▒ anda ad─▒n─▒ de─či┼čtirdim :). Yani bu tarz kendimize ├Âzel ├ž├Âz├╝mler de ├╝retebiliriz demek istiyorum.

├ľncelikle programlamaya yeni ba┼člayan arkada┼člara ├Ânerim her zaman en g├╝ncel programlar ile programlamaya ba┼člamalar─▒d─▒r. ┼×imdi y─▒l olmu┼č 2013, visual stdio 2012 ├ž─▒km─▒┼č. Ben gidipte 2005 i bilgisayar─▒ma kurup ba┼člarsam ├žok yanl─▒┼č olur. ├ç├╝nk├╝ art─▒k piyasada herkes g├╝ncelli─če ├Ânem veriyor art─▒k kimse eskiye bakm─▒yor. ┼×imdi ben visual stdio 2005 i kurar ├Â─črenirim kullan─▒m olarak. Sonra i┼če girdi─čimde 2012 kullan─▒nca arad─▒─č─▒m─▒ bulamam ve bir daha 2012 de kullan─▒m─▒ ├Â─črenmem gerekir. Kullan─▒mdan kast─▒m visual stdio kullan─▒m─▒ kod de─čil yanl─▒┼č anla┼č─▒lmas─▒n kod olarak hi├žbir fark─▒ yok yani for, if 2005 de de ayn─▒ 2012 dede :).

Neyse san─▒r─▒m programlamaya yeni ba┼člayan arkada┼člara biraz da olsa yard─▒mc─▒ olabilmi┼čimdir. Art─▒k hangi programlama dili ile ba┼člayacaklar─▒n─▒ biraz daha iyi anlam─▒┼čt─▒rlar.